But you do remember that there must be two separate circuits? Well water must under no circumstances come into contact with the "normal" fresh water. In this respect, it would have been sensible to do the analysis BEFORE laying the additional pipe.

If you don’t want a perfect golf lawn, usually yes. If it doesn’t rain for a long time in summer, you can also water a bit with the mobile sprinkler. If you water constantly, you also have to mow the lawn constantly ;)
It’s a bit different with the vegetable garden, it needs a bit more water.

And of course, you have to water regularly during the establishment phase. But you can also coordinate the sowing a bit with the weather.
